Thursday, April 28, 2005

Toads comma Exploding

I'm actually going to issue a warning on this one: this is not only really gross, but a little bit sad. Here's the long and short of it. Toads in Europe are exploding The scientists whose job it is to study this sort of thing aren't sure why, but one possible answer sounds quite like Hitchcock.

Did I mention that this story is pretty gross?


